How Do I Choose Core Brand Words for a Combine Business?

Start with the fundamentals: the equipment type, regional identifier, and a value promise. For example, "Harvest", "Field", "Midwest", or "Yield" can anchor your brainstorming. Checkpoint: Have you listed three core words that reflect both function and geography?

When Should I Trust AI Suggestions Over Manual Brainstorming?

AI‑assisted generators are great for volume—spitting out 20‑plus ideas in seconds. However, AI lacks the nuance of regional farming slang and the subtle trust signals a farmer looks for. Use AI to seed ideas, then apply your industry knowledge to prune the list. Checkpoint: Have you manually vetted the top three AI suggestions for local relevance?
